SOM Strengthens Interior Design Practice, Hiring Three New Leaders

SOM welcomes three new practice leaders—Lois Wellwood, Jeannette Lenear Peruchini, and Susan Orlandi—whose collective experience bolsters the firm’s award-winning Interior Design studio. These strategic hires reinforce the design teams in New York, Chicago, and San Francisco, expanding the local and global reach of SOM’s firmwide Interiors practice. “We are committed to designing interiors that foster innovation and collaboration,” said SOM Interior Design Partner Stephen Apking. “These three exceptional leaders add to the depth of expertise that our Interiors studio brings to each project.”

“I am thrilled to join SOM, where interior design is fully integrated into the firm’s unparalleled range and depth of expertise,” said Lois Wellwood, who joins SOM’s New York office as an Associate Director and Interiors Practice Leader. She is an expert in transformational workplace strategies, retail, hospitality, and integrated brand design, with over 25 years of experience in programming, planning, design and management of large, complex projects. She most recently served as Principal at NBBJ, where she directed initiatives related to design, client development, and strategic growth. Her portfolio includes Metrotech Global Technology Headquarters in New York, the headquarters for a technology company in Seattle, and an 800,000-square-foot office repositioning project for Shell Canada in Calgary.

Wellwood served on the board of directors for CREW Calgary and the coordination committee for the CREW 2012 Montreal conference. She has also served on the boards of directors for CoreNet Washington State Chapter, and Design in Public, an initiative of AIA Seattle. She has a Bachelor of Interior Design from the University of Manitoba.

Jeannette Lenear Peruchini has more than 15 years of experience as a designer, project manager, and business development lead. She joins SOM’s Chicago office as an Associate Director and Interior Design Leader. With her belief that design can help organizations reshape their cultures, she strengthens SOM’s thought leadership in workplace design, working across disciplines to help clients meet the needs of a diverse, multi-generational workforce. “This is an opportunity to lead an innovative, collaborative team,” she says. “SOM is uniquely positioned to develop holistic solutions that anticipate and respond to the ever-changing workplace.”

Peruchini worked as a landscape architect and project manager before becoming a vice president for international business development, leading large teams in the U.S. and abroad. In her previous role at VOA Associates, she established a local office in Dubai and grew the firm’s presence in the region. She returned to Chicago to lead business development for VOA’s workplace interiors studio and was promoted to lead the interiors group in 2011. She is an active member of CoreNet Global and the Chicago Executives’ Club, and serves on Contract magazine’s editorial advisory board. She has a Master of Business Administration from the University of Notre Dame and a Bachelor of Landscape Architecture from the University of Illinois Urbana-Champaign.

In the San Francisco office, Susan Orlandi joins SOM as Associate Director and West Coast Interior Design Leader. “SOM has an incredible legacy of innovation—an 80-year history of designing forward thinking interiors,” said Orlandi. “I’m excited to be a part of the firm’s next generation of leadership.” With over 30 years of experience in workplace programming, space planning, interior architecture, and furniture solutions, Orlandi most recently served as Design Director in Gensler’s San Jose office. Her wide array of projects includes workplaces for Western Digital/HGST, HP, Chevron, PG&E, McCann Worldgroup, Publicis Riney, Apple, IBM, and many others. At SOM, she is overseeing a 300,000-square-foot workplace interiors project for a technology company in San Francisco.

Working with clients to find innovative solutions to complex design problems, Orlandi seeks to create experiential spaces that enrich the lives of the people who work in them. With vast experience in design management, conceptual design, design development, branding design, construction documentation and administration, as well as in furniture and finish selections, Orlandi is able to ensure the efficiency of the entire design execution process. She has a Bachelor in Interior Architectural Design from California State University, Long Beach.
